Federated Hermes, Inc. Reports First Quarter 2020 Earnings

FHI

- Q1 2020 EPS of $0.63 compared to $0.54 for Q1 2019 - Managed assets reach a record $605.8 billion - Board declares $0.27 per share quarterly dividend

PITTSBURGH, April 30, 2020 /PRNewswire/ -- Federated Hermes, Inc. (NYSE: FHI), a leading global investment manager, today reported earnings per diluted share (EPS) of $0.63 for Q1 2020, compared to $0.54 for the same quarter last year, on net income of $64.2 million for Q1 2020, compared to $54.5 million for Q1 2019.

Federated Hermes' total managed assets were a record $605.8 billion at March 31, 2020, up $120.9 billion or 25% from $484.9 billion at March 31, 2019 and up $29.9 billion or 5% from $575.9 billion at Dec. 31, 2019. Total average managed assets for Q1 2020 were $580.2 billion, up $104.8 billion or 22% from $475.4 billion reported for Q1 2019 and up $30.1 billion or 5% from $550.1 billion reported for Q4 2019.

"In the first quarter, Federated Hermes saw interest in our Kaufmann growth strategies, which invest in companies seeking to capitalize on innovation," Donahue said. "Investors seeking haven from volatile markets turned to our liquidity strategies, while we also experienced net sales in various long-term strategies, including Hermes global equity and SDG engagement funds, the Federated Government Ultrashort Duration Fund and the Federated Prudent Bear Fund."

Federated Hermes' board of directors declared a quarterly dividend of $0.27 per share. The dividend is payable on May 15, 2020 to shareholders of record as of May 11, 2020. During Q1 2020, Federated Hermes purchased 714,251 shares of Federated Hermes class B common stock for $16.0 million.

Equity assets were $68.2 billion at March 31, 2020, down $12.0 billion or 15% from $80.2 billion at March 31, 2019 and down $20.8 billion or 23% from $89.0 billion at Dec. 31, 2019. The decreases largely resulted from declines in the market value of investments from the impact of the coronavirus. Top-selling equity funds during Q1 2020 on a net basis were Federated Kaufmann Small Cap Fund, Hermes Global Emerging Markets Fund, Hermes SDG Engagement Equity Fund, Hermes Global Equity ESG Fund and Federated Kaufmann Large Cap Fund.

Fixed-income assets were $64.7 billion at March 31, 2020, up $0.6 billion or 1% from $64.1 billion at March 31, 2019 and down $4.3 billion or 6% from $69.0 billion at Dec. 31, 2019. Top-selling fixed-income funds during Q1 2020 on a net basis were Federated Government Ultrashort Duration Fund, Capital Preservation Fund, Hermes SDG Engagement High Yield Credit Fund, Federated Short-Intermediate Total Return Bond Fund and Federated Total Return Government Bond Fund.

Money market assets were a record $451.3 billion at March 31, 2020, up $132.9 billion or 42% from $318.4 billion at March 31, 2019 and up $55.8 billion or 14% from $395.5 billion at Dec. 31, 2019. Money market fund assets were $336.1 billion at March 31, 2020, up $121.3 billion or 56% from $214.8 billion at March 31, 2019 and up $49.5 billion or 17% from $286.6 billion at Dec. 31, 2019.

Financial Summary

Q1 2020 vs. Q1 2019

Revenue increased $52.1 million or 17% primarily due to higher average money market and equity assets.

During Q1 2020, Federated Hermes derived 56% of its revenue from long-term assets (38% from equity assets, 13% from fixed-income assets and 5% from alternative/private markets and multi-asset), 43% from money market assets, and 1% from sources other than managed assets.

Operating expenses increased $30.3 million or 13% primarily due to an increase in distribution expenses associated with higher average money market fund assets.

Nonoperating income (expenses), net decreased $8.7 million due to a decrease in the market value of investments, which declined primarily due to the coronavirus' impact on the markets. This decrease was partially offset by a gain from a fair value adjustment to the equity investment of a previously nonconsolidated entity.

Q1 2020 vs. Q4 2019

Revenue increased $1.2 million primarily due to higher average money market assets.

Operating expenses increased $11.2 million or 4% primarily due to an increase in compensation and related expenses as well as distribution expenses associated with higher average money market fund assets.

Nonoperating income (expenses), net decreased $15.9 million due to a decrease in the market value of investments, which declined primarily due to the coronavirus' impact on the markets. This decrease was partially offset by a gain from a fair value adjustment to the equity investment of a previously nonconsolidated entity.

Federated Hermes, Inc. is a leading global investment manager with $605.8 billion in assets under management as of March 31, 2020. Our investment solutions span 163 equity, fixed-income, alternative/private markets, multi-asset and liquidity management strategies, and a range of separately managed account strategies. Providing comprehensive investment management to more than 11,000 institutions and intermediaries, our clients include corporations, government entities, insurance companies, foundations and endowments, banks and broker/dealers. Headquartered in Pittsburgh, Federated Hermes' more than 1,900 employees include those in New York, Boston, London and several other offices worldwide.

Federated Hermes ranks in the top 6% of equity fund managers in the industry, the top 7% of money market fund managers and the top 11% of fixed-income fund managers1. Federated Hermes also ranks as the 13th-largest SMA manager2. Information regarding Hermes is available at Hermes-Investment.com.
